Hi all,

How can I reduce disk space postgresql used ?
I tried to delete many rows from my database and
I am running ' vacuum analyze reindexdb ' commands regularly
but my disk space on my linux machine didn't reduce.

I know that ' vacuum full ' command can do that but I don't want to use
that command because of the disadvantages.

Anyone know another method ?
